What I Actually Do

Stephanie runs Root & Branch Wellness, functional medicine and acupuncture for cycle issues, PCOS, perimenopause, fertility and pregnancy loss support, labor prep, gut and fatigue complaints, and the patients who've been through every workup with no answers. She works as an extension of a patient's existing care team, not a replacement, and wants labs and notes in hand before she starts.

When to Refer to Me

Refer to Root & Branch Wellness for irregular or heavy cycles, PMS/PMDD, PCOS, perimenopause and menopause symptoms, fertility support (including recurrent early pregnancy loss and IUI/IVF support), pain during pregnancy or postpartum, labor preparation acupuncture in the final weeks, chronic bloating or GI dysbiosis, unexplained fatigue or brain fog, and musculoskeletal pain or sports injuries. Also a good fit for patients who've had extensive workups with no clear answers and want a root-cause, whole-person approach alongside their existing care team.

How We Work Together

I work as an extension of a patient's existing care team rather than in place of it. Once referred, I typically request any relevant labs, imaging, or diagnoses the patient already has (including OB or RE notes for fertility and pregnancy cases) so treatment is coordinated rather than duplicated. I'm happy to communicate directly with referring providers as needed, whether that's a quick note on a patient's plan or ongoing updates for shared cases. I collaborate especially well with OBs, reproductive endocrinologists, primary care physicians, pelvic floor physical therapists, registered dietitians, and doulas and birth workers, since our approaches tend to complement each other well across women's health, fertility, and pregnancy/postpartum care.

We offer telehealth services for functional medicine and herbal consultations and also offer pain management in the office.
